The Division of the Budget (DOB) prepares the annual Executive Budget pursuant to the Governor's direction and policy objectives. DOB's professional staff of budget examiners provide analytical support and advice to the Governor and his senior staff preceding and during budget negotiations with the Legislature, and execute the budget as adopted into law. DOB also serves as the Governor's primary advisor on such fiscal matters as local government and public authority finances, and seeks to ensure that State funds are spent economically and efficiently throughout the fiscal year, consistent with the State's Financial Plan.
